Abstract

This invention relates to an improved method and mechanism for eliminating acceleration-dependent errors and loop interaction effects in gain-stabilized, closed-loop, interferometric fiber optic gyroscopes. Such method and mechanism include enabling the modulation gain accumulator and disabling the rate accumulator on every occurrence of ramp flyback if the gyroscope is operating below a certain velocity threshold and enabling the modulation gain accumulator and disabling the rate accumulator on one out of every N occurrences of ramp flyback if the gyroscope is operating above a certain velocity threshold. Such method and mechanism also includes use of proportional circuitry to scale the magnitude of the bias modulation component to be a percentage of the serrodyne ramp voltage and the DC component to be zero volts.
